Masked artists are ubiquitous in electronic music, from mouse-headed Deadmau5 to robot-helmeted Daft Punk. But Marshmello's stratospheric ascent has been faster than any of his occult compatriots: shrewd marketing and contagious success led him thereForbes'rank annually thereThe highest paid DJs in the worldless than two years after its first public performance. The independent artist earned $21 million before taxes for the 12 months ended June 2017 thanks to over 170 shows grossing over $150,000 per show.ForbesExpensive.
The identity of the man in the white mask can be traced through music licensing manager BMI, where Marshmello is registered as a songwriter and performer. The BMI's public database links pseudonyms with real names, i.e. searchmalvaviscothe whyComstockunder his real name produced the same results and proved that Comstock is Marshmello.

From Lil Wayne to Lady Gaga, each artist's legal name represents the same track listing as their stage name. Each pseudonym is identified by a different nine-digit number or CAE/IPI; As a rule, pseudonyms differ only slightly from the real name CAE/IPI. In the case of Marshmello and the other artists mentioned, there is a difference of 98 between the pseudonymsCAE/IGE and company nameCAE/IPI. Such similarity is usually due to the fact that both the legal name and the pseudonym are applied for in quick succession.
But just 12 hours after emailing Marshmello management asking for comments with links to the BMI database showing the same results for Comstock and Marshmello, Comstock was removed from the BMI website. A search for Comstock as the composer yielded no results. A track by Borgore and Dotcom, "Nope", previously surfaced in searches for Comstock and his alias Marshmello, has also been removed from the online playlist. Additional evidence comes from his holding company, Marshmello Creative, LLC. Founded in Delaware in August 2015, the company's only publicly traded executive is Christopher Comstock. Comstock is also listed as the sole administrator of Dotcom Music, LLC, the organization associated with his former nickname.
Marshmello's identity has also been confirmedForbesby several industry experts who spoke on condition of anonymity. One said: "It's absolutely the same guy."

But the pseudonym served as a useful marketing tool for the artist, who had previously tried to gain a foothold as a dot-com with a different sound, public name and face. "We thought, 'How can we create something that isn't defined by who it is or what it is about?'" his manager Moe Shalizi.said Forbes in August"We're creating another faceless brand."
It worked: "Alone" went platinum last month, while its video has nearly 140 million views on YouTube. His touring prowess is such that he can book up to three shows in one day. "Demand for Marshmello exceeds its availability," said Steve Gordon, Marshmello's booking agent and co-owner of Circle Talent Agency.

What was marshmallows originally made for? ›Ancient Egyptians were said to be the first to make and use the root of the plant to soothe coughs and sore throats and to heal wounds. The first marshmallows were prepared by boiling pieces of root pulp with honey until thick. Once thickened, the mixture was strained, cooled, then used as intended.
What is the history of the marshmallow? ›2000 B.C. Ancient Egyptians discover a wild herb growing in marshland from which a sweet substance could be extracted. This substance, the sap of the marshmallow plant, is combined with a honey-based candy recipe to create a confection so delightful that it's reserved only for the pharaohs and the gods.
